THE Lord Crewe Arms at Blanchland has added to its collection of accolades after being named as the Inn of the Year by the Good Pub Guide 2018.
The annual publication is produced as a result of regular feedback from customers as well as random inspections by its editors.
General manager Tommy Mark said: “With such strong competition across the whole of the UK, to be singled out for this title is a tremendous coup.
“This is a big pat on the back to all the team for their hard work.
“It’s a fantastic accolade which follows hot on the heels of many others over the last couple of years.”
